Web12 apr. 2024 · Internal condoms are single-use and aren't to be used with an external condom. When used correctly, internal condoms are 95 percent effective at preventing pregnancy and can help reduce the rate of sexually transmitted infections (STIs). However, nobody's perfect, and the effectiveness rate with "typical" use is about 79 percent.

Though male condoms have proved efficacy for STI prevention in … dye in heartWebFemale condom —Worn by the woman, the female condom helps keeps sperm from getting into her body. It is packaged with a lubricant and is available at drug stores. It can be inserted up to eight hours before sexual intercourse. Typical use failure rate: 21%, 1 and also may help prevent STDs. dyeing yarn with easter egg dye
